A SHEEP was mauled to death by a dog in what police have described as a “vicious livestock attack” in rural Wrexham county.

Horror attack on sheep by 'powerful dog'

Officers believe the injuries were inflicted by a “large, powerful dog” and said it would have returned to its owner covered in blood.

The attack took place in a field adjacent to Pendre Farm in the Pontfadog area between Chirk and Llangollen, last Tuesday.

The sheep is believed to have been chased by the dog, sustaining fatal neck injuries.

North Wales Police (NWP) is now appealing for information from the public.
